Psychogenic Fugue
A rare psychiatric disorder characterized by temporary amnesia for personal identity, including the memories, personality, and other identifying characteristics of individuality.
Manic Disorder
A mental health condition characterized by extremely elevated mood, energy levels, and often risky behavior, typically seen in bipolar disorder.
Generalized Anxiety Disorder
A mental health disorder characterized by persistent and excessive worry about various aspects of life, often interfering with daily functioning.
Dissociative Disorder
A psychological condition characterized by a disconnection and lack of continuity between thoughts, memories, surroundings, actions, and identity.
